Introduction: The Evolution of Digital Board Gaming
Over the past decade, the landscape of digital gaming has experienced a paradigm shift, particularly within the genre of turn-based strategy (TBS). Once dominated by complex PC titles and console classics, the genre is now increasingly diversifying through innovative platforms that merge traditional tabletop mechanics with modern digital technology. As players seek more engaging, accessible, and creatively rich experiences, the industry has responded with a new wave of digital board games that emphasize strategic thinking paired with user-friendly interfaces.
Industry Insights: Data Reflecting Growth and Innovation
Recent industry reports underscore the remarkable growth of the digital board game segment. Retail sales of such titles have increased by approximately 25% in the last fiscal year (Statista, 2023), driven by heightened demand for remote social activities during periods of social distancing. Furthermore, digital adaptations of classic board games like Settlers of Catan and Ticket to Ride have seen renewed popularity, yet the true evolution lies in innovative titles that challenge traditional gameplay conventions.
A notable trend is the emergence of hybrid games that incorporate narrative elements, strategic depth, and multiplayer connectivity seamlessly. Industry leaders are emphasizing not only fidelity to classic mechanics but also the integration of new features such as real-time collaboration, AI-driven opponents, and augmented reality components.
Design Principles Powering Modern Digital Board Games
Successful digital board games leverage specific design principles that make them accessible yet strategically challenging:
- Intuitive User Interfaces: Ensuring ease of learning without sacrificing depth.
- Adaptive AI Opponents: Providing scalable difficulty to accommodate casual and seasoned players.
- Online Connectivity: Facilitating multiplayer games that transcend geographical boundaries.
- Rich Visuals & Narratives: Immersive environments that enhance engagement.
- Cross-Platform Accessibility: Allowing gameplay on desktops, tablets, and smartphones.
Designing with these principles in mind results in games that are not only enjoyable but also foster long-term engagement.
Case Study: The Role of Interactive Digital Games in Strategy Development
Beyond entertainment, digital strategy games have found significant application in educational and professional contexts, serving as tools for critical thinking, resource management, and collaborative problem-solving. For instance, certain digital games simulate complex logistics, finance, or political scenarios, enabling players to develop real-world skills in a controlled, engaging environment.
This convergence of entertainment and education exemplifies how innovation within digital board gaming can lead to broader societal benefits, making gameplay a valuable tool for learning and development.
